How To Dress Well to play London show with Koreless

R&B swooner How To Dress Well has been announced to play a headline show at London’s 100 Club later this month as part of the Converse Gigs series.
The songwriter and producer will play the intimate gig on Wednesday 23 April with support on the night coming from Glasgow electronic musician Koreless.
Last week, How To Dress Well announced new album What Is This Heart?, following on from recently-shared tracks “Words I Don’t Remember” and “Repeat Pleasure”.
This upcoming gig comes after recent performances from Blood Orange and A$AP Ferg at the venue. Tickets will be available for free on the Converse UK website from Tuesday 8 April.
